Given an arithmetic progression 15 19 23 what number is in this sequence in 9th place?

In this arithmetic progression, the first term is a1 = 15.
Let’s find what is the difference of the given arithmetic progression:
d = 19 – 15 = 23 – 19 = 4.
The n-th member of the arithmetic progression is: an = a 1 + d * (n – 1).
It is required to find the 9th term of this arithmetic progression, that is, n = 9. We get:
a9 = 15 + 4 * (9 – 1),
a9 = 15 + 4 * 8,
a9 = 47.
Answer: 47.
